In the fast-evolving world of cybersecurity, staying informed about security updates is crucial for maintaining the integrity of internet communications. A recent vulnerability identified, logged as DSA-5764-1, points to a significant issue in OpenSSL, a widely used Secure Sockets Layer (SSL) toolkit. This article dives deep into the nature of this vulnerability, its potential impacts, and what steps you can take to safeguard your systems.
Discovered by David Benjamin, this vulnerability lies in the OpenSSL library - specifically within the X.509 name checks. The X.509 certificates are a vital part of SSL/TLS protocols, which provide security over internet communications. The flaw can cause applications executing those certificate name checks to crash, leading to a potential denial of service (DoS). This type of vulnerability affects not just individual users but can have far-reaching effects on servers and services depending extensively on SSL/TLS for secure communications.
The X.509 name checking flaw involves incorrect handling of certain fields within a certificate. This mishandling leads to a condition known as a 'NULL pointer dereference' - a common type of bug that causes a program to crash when trying to access memory that hasn't been allocated. In practical terms, if a malicious certificate were presented for verification, it could exploit this flaw to initiate a denial of service attack against the affected service. This is particularly alarming given the widespread use of OpenSSL in various internet-facing applications.
This security loophole places numerous systems at risk - primarily servers that handle SSL/TLS decryption and encryption tasks. The potential for service interruptions and system crashes is not to be underestimated, as these can lead to broader disruptions in online services and negatively affect business operations and user trust. Cyber adversaries could potentially exploit such vulnerabilities to obstruct services that rely on SSL/TLS for security, compounding the risk of data breaches and other security issues.
To minimize the risk associated with this OpenSSL flaw, immediate steps should be prioritized by organizations and system administrators. Updating OpenSSL to the latest patched version as suggested in the security advisory from OpenSSL (fix provided in version 1.1.1 and later) is crucial. Ensuring that your system's security patches are up-to-date can largely prevent the exploitation of such vulnerabilities.
Additionally, it's advisable to perform regular checks and audits of the cryptographic standards and implementations your systems use. Cryptographic vulnerabilities like the one described can often go unnoticed until they are exploited, making proactive assessments and updates a cornerstone of a robust cybersecurity defense strategy.
Understanding and addressing security vulnerabilities is essential for maintaining the integrity and security of digital communications. The DSA-5764-1 OpenSSL vulnerability highlights the need for vigilant and ongoing management of security systems to guard against evolving threats. For more information and detailed guidance on updating your systems, visit our website at LinuxPatch.com.